Merlin is a venture backed aerospace startup building a non?human pilot to enable both reduced crew and uncrewed flight. Backed by some of the worlds leading investors, Merlin is scaling alongside our customers to begin leveraging autonomy today to solve some of aviations biggest challenges. About You
You are a proactive and detail?oriented DevOps Engineer with a passion for building scalable, secure, and automated infrastructure. You thrive in fast?paced environments and enjoy collaborating across teams to streamline development workflows, improve CI/CD pipelines, and ensure system reliability. With a solid foundation in cloud platforms (such as AWS, Azure, or GCP), infrastructure as code (like Terraform or CloudFormation), and containerization tools (Docker, Kubernetes), you bring both technical depth and a strong problem?solving mindset to the table. You are driven by continuous improvement and eager to contribute to a culture of operational excellence. The Role Develop and maintain CI/CD pipelines for our software development team. Automate and improve software build and deployment to our test systems, from software?in?the?loop all the way up to flight?test aircraft. Support Database Management activities in the context of ML/NLP. Coordinate between our software, flight?test, and IT teams to ensure tools and infrastructure support all of our activities. Document and communicate work to encourage uptake of new tools around the team.
Qualifications
BS in Computer Science or a related subject, or equivalent experience. 5+ years of experience in DevOps roles. Demonstrable deep experience with Linux, Git, Docker, AWS, CI/CD tools, relational database management and configuration, infrastructure and configuration management tools like Terraform or Ansible. AWS and Azure experience.
Bonus
Knowledge of networking and network security best practices. Experience supporting ML workflows. Experience managing MySQL, MariaDB, or PostgreSQL. Experience with software products that include a physical systems component, such as aircraft and robotics.
